Hi, I'm trying to make a plasma cut sheet metal "art" piece. I cant export this flat pattern as an .DXF. Would anyone with more experience be able to take a look at the file and possibly spot the issue? the problem seem to be in the bottom part of the piece since if i extrude only the top half i can export it as flat pattern .DXF without any problems.

I understand that the problem is with the old software they use at the company where i'm an employee. But since that is the only CNC plasma cutter i have access to i try to find workarounds. However, i still get the error message when trying to export as DXF from flat pattern with the box for converting splines to polylines ticked (tolerance 0.10mm)

ErrorError

 

I've found some crossing sketchlines when zooming in very, very close. i wish fusion360 could give me more information to work with. the error message is very light in information. about the problem it encountered. so i would know what to troubleshoot, or where to look.
